Frequently Asked Questions about eStatements
1. What is the eStatement service?
Our eStatement service is a fast and easy way to view your Langley Federal Credit Union (LFCU) statements on a secure Internet site — for FREE! They replace the printed statements you receive in the mail each month. Your on-line statement looks similar to the printed version, and you can access archived statements for the past 24 months.
2. How much does it cost to use eStatements?
eStatements are a free electronic service provided for the convenience of Langley Federal Credit Union members.
3. How do I sign up to receive eStatements?
After signing on to L@ngley Link home banking, click the Statement button, then the eStatement button. Review the Terms Of Use. If you agree to them, you'll be taken to a simple enrollment form where you can configure the email address you want to use for receiving notices when new eStatements are ready. When you complete the form, you'll be enrolled, but you must validate your information.

Validation is simple. LFCU will send a validation email to the address you configured. It will contain a special hyperlink which most members can simply click to complete activation. In some rare cases, you may have to manually type the code into a form on the LFCU site. Clear instructions are provided in the validation email.

18. How is the integrity of my data maintained using Internet access with SSL protocol?
LFCU eStatements use the industry standard technology and techniques to help ensure that your statement information is as secure as possible. These techniques include multi-factor authentication, data encryption, and the use of secure servers, which are designed to keep out potential intruders. The eStatements site uses the Secure Socket Layer (SSL) protocol to encrypt sensitive data prior to transmission over the Internet so it is protected from anyone attempting to read it in transit. On-line log monitoring and analysis are conducted to detect break-in attempts and other problems. There is strong encryption between the client and Web server, as well as between the Web server and back-end systems.
19. I signed up for eStatements a few days ago and I haven't received my eStatement activation message. What could be the problem?
It is possible that either your email provider or the settings within your email software has handled the eStatement message as junk email.

For users of Microsoft Outlook® messaging and collaboration client:

Check Junk Mail settings in Outlook:
  1. Open Microsoft Outlook
  2. On the toolbar, click Organize
  3. Click Junk Email
  4. Check the options you have selected for Junk Email organization
To Make an Exception to your Junk Mail list:
  1. On the Tools menu, click Rules Wizard.
  2. In the Apply rules in the following order box, click Exception List.
  3. In the Rule description box, click Exception List.
  4. Click Add.
  5. Enter the email address you want to make an exception for. In this case, the email is notifications@lfcustatements.org.
Messages sent from the email address you enter will appear in your Inbox as usual, even if the email address is part of a domain listed in your Junk Senders list. Any rules you applied to the domain will not be applied to this sender. If you feel that your email provider may be blocking the email with spam filters, please contact your provider to remove the block.
